Pa. man charged in mom's slaying

CRESSON, Pa. - A western Pennsylvania man has been charged with shooting his mother to death after he crashed his car a few blocks from home.

State police at Ebensburg say Andrew Choros, 23, was arrested Friday and charged with first-degree murder in the death of Sharon Choros, 50, a school nurse, in her home in Cresson Township, Cambria County.

Township police said Andrew Choros, a student at St. Francis University, had been arrested about noon Friday on suspicion of DUI. State police say that after his release he started shooting in the house, and the victim was shot when she returned home.

Choros was being held without bond at Cambria County prison.
